Description / Scope of Work
Punjab Tianjin University of Technology, Lahore (PTUT) invites sealed bids for the purchase of air conditioner units under bid reference PTUT/PC/02/2026-27. This procurement is being conducted through a single stage single envelope bidding procedure. The bid opening venue is the Conference Room at PTUT in Lahore, Punjab. Bidders are required to obtain bid documents by 10:00 A.M. on 18th August 2026, with submission of completed bids by 11:00 A.M. on the same date. The bid documents will be opened at 11:30 A.M. on 18th August 2026 at the designated venue.
Eligible bidders must meet the qualification criteria and provide all required documentation establishing their eligibility and the conformity of goods to the bidding documents. Bidders are required to submit bid security as specified in the bid data sheet. The period of validity of bids shall be as stated in the bid data sheet. All bids must be properly sealed, marked, and submitted in accordance with the sealing and marking procedures outlined in the bidding documents. Bids submitted after the deadline will not be considered. Bidders may request clarifications on the bidding documents up to the deadline for obtaining documents.
Bidders should obtain complete bidding documents including technical specifications, general conditions of contract, special conditions of contract, and bid data sheet from PTUT. Submission of bids should be made to the Conference Room PTUT on or before 11:00 A.M. on 18th August 2026. The procuring agency reserves the right to vary quantities at the time of award, accept or reject all bids, and conduct re-bidding if necessary. Post-qualification and evaluation of bids will be conducted as per the evaluation criteria specified in the bidding documents.
